The third edition of Royal Stag BoomBox – The Original Sound of Generation Large launched in Guwahati’s Saru Sajai Stadium Complex on March 1, reinforcing the growing economic significance of India’s live music sector. By blending Bollywood melodies with hip-hop beats, the festival has positioned itself as a major driver of cultural tourism and local business growth.
With electrifying performances by DJ Yogii, rapper Ikka, singer Nikhita Gandhi, and a grand finale by Armaan Malik, the event attracted thousands of attendees. Alongside music, interactive zones, art installations, and food experiences contributed to a vibrant economic ecosystem, benefiting vendors, hospitality, and tourism sectors.
Kartik Mohindra, Chief Marketing Officer, Pernod Ricard India, stated, “Royal Stag BoomBox is more than music—it’s an economic force, creating opportunities for artists, businesses, and local communities.” With three more cities to follow, the festival is set to deepen its impact on India’s entertainment economy.
